What to Expect During a Boudoir Photo Shoot for Couples

Alright, let’s talk logistics. What happens during a boudoir photo shoot for couples? Well, it’s a mix of planning, creativity, and a whole lot of fun. From choosing outfits to picking locations, every detail matters. Let’s break it down for you.

Picking the Perfect Location

Location plays a huge role in setting the mood. Some couples prefer indoor studios with controlled lighting, while others love outdoor settings like beaches, gardens, or rustic barns. It all depends on what vibe you’re going for. If you’re unsure, your photographer can guide you based on their expertise.

Choosing Outfits That Reflect Your Style

When it comes to clothing, comfort is key. You don’t have to go overboard with fancy lingerie or suits unless that’s your thing. Simple, elegant pieces that make you feel confident are perfect. Don’t forget accessories—they add that extra touch of personality. Oh, and don’t stress too much about matching outfits. As long as your styles complement each other, you’re good to go.

Posing Tips for Beginners

Posing can feel awkward at first, but trust me, it gets easier. Your photographer will likely give you some direction, but here are a few tips to keep in mind:

  • Relax your shoulders and breathe naturally.
  • Play with angles—tilt your head slightly or turn your body a bit.
  • Focus on each other instead of the camera. That connection is what makes the photos magical.
  • Don’t be afraid to laugh or share inside jokes. Genuine moments make the best memories.

Remember, this isn’t a fashion shoot. It’s about capturing real emotions and chemistry.

How to Prepare for Your Boudoir Photo Shoot

Preparation is key to ensuring your boudoir photo shoot goes smoothly. Here’s a quick checklist to help you get ready:

1. Set Clear Expectations

Talk to your partner about what you both want from the session. Are you aiming for sultry vibes or something more playful? Communicating your vision upfront will help your photographer tailor the experience to your needs.

2. Choose a Reputable Photographer

Not all photographers specialize in boudoir photography, so do your research. Look for someone whose work resonates with you and who has experience shooting couples. Reading reviews and checking their portfolio can give you a good idea of their style.

3. Take Care of Yourself

Leading up to the shoot, take care of your skin, hair, and overall well-being. Get a manicure, pedicure, or even a massage if it helps you relax. Confidence comes from feeling good inside and out.

4. Practice Poses Together

While your photographer will guide you, practicing a few poses beforehand can ease any nerves. Use your phone to snap some test shots and see what works for you both.

Trust me, putting in a little effort will pay off big time when you see the final results.

Cost Considerations for Boudoir Photo Shoots

Let’s talk money because let’s face it, budget matters. Boudoir photo shoots for couples can vary widely in price depending on factors like location, duration, and the photographer’s experience. On average, you can expect to pay anywhere from $300 to $1,500 or more. Some packages include digital files, prints, or albums, while others may charge extra for these add-ons.

Factors That Affect Pricing

  • Photographer’s Experience: More experienced photographers tend to charge higher rates.
  • Session Length: Longer sessions usually cost more.
  • Post-Production: Editing, retouching, and additional services can increase the total cost.
  • Location: Travel fees might apply if you choose a remote spot.

Pro tip: Always ask for a detailed breakdown of costs before booking. Transparency is key!

How to Choose the Right Photographer

Selecting the right photographer is crucial for a successful boudoir photo shoot. Here’s how to find the perfect fit:

1. Look at Their Portfolio

A photographer’s portfolio is a window into their style. Pay attention to lighting, composition, and how they capture emotion. Do their photos resonate with you?

2. Read Reviews and Testimonials

What past clients say speaks volumes. Look for feedback on communication, professionalism, and the overall experience.

3. Schedule a Consultation

Meeting your photographer beforehand can help you gauge their personality and working style. It’s also a great chance to discuss your vision and ask questions.

4. Ask About Their Process

Understanding their workflow—from pre-shoot planning to post-production—can ensure you’re on the same page.

Choosing the right photographer can make all the difference in bringing your vision to life.
